I'm less concerned about the stated limit than what size slot it is ... according to the PCI-E spec, all **full height** x16 slots MUST be capable of handling 75 watts so as the post says, this may be more related to PSU size.
GT 730 DDR3, 64-bit = 23 watts
GT 730 GDDR5 = 25 watts
